Types of Car Keys
Comprehending the different types of car keys available is important in determining the very best replacement alternative. Here's a breakdown of the most typical types:
Type of Car KeyDescriptionRequirement KeysThese are standard metal keys with no electronic components. They are simple to replicate and affordable.Transponder KeysGeared up with a chip that communicates with the car's ignition system, these keys are created to prevent unauthorized access.Key FobsRemote control units that offer keyless entry and ignition functions. They are typically used in more recent designs.Smart KeysAdvanced keys that allow for keyless entry and ignition, utilizing distance sensors.Valet KeysSimplified keys designed to limit access to particular functionalities, mostly for valet services.The Evolution of Car Keys
Car keys have developed considerably over the years. From easy metal keys to technically sophisticated wise keys, the following points highlight this evolution:
Early Days: Traditional metal keys supplied access to cars without any additional functions.Transponder Technology: Introduced in the 1990s, transponder keys improved vehicle security by preventing unauthorized duplication.Remote Access: Key fobs supplied the benefit of remote locking and opening, paving the method for clever car innovations.Smart Keys: The most current version allows for seamless access and ignition, often working merely by being in distance to the vehicle.How to Obtain Replacement Car Keys
Getting a replacement car key can be an uncomplicated or complicated procedure, depending on the type of key and the particular vehicle model. Here are the actions included:
1. Identify Your Key Type
Determine which kind of key you have. This will assist you choose the right technique to get a replacement.
2. Find Your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
The VIN, usually found on the control panel or inside the chauffeur's door frame, is essential for locksmith professionals and dealerships when configuring a brand-new key.
3. Choose Your Replacement Option
Car owners can go with various routes for replacements:

Dealerships: Often the most pricey option, but dealerships have the manufacturer's requirements required for sophisticated key types.

Local Locksmiths: Usually a more cost-effective alternative, especially for standard and transponder keys.

Online Services: Some online platforms offer key duplication services, supplying a more affordable option for basic keys.

Automotive Lockout Services: If locked out of one's car, mobile locksmith professional services can typically produce a replacement key on-site.
4. Supply Necessary Documentation
To get a replacement, individuals may need to supply proof of ownership and recognition. This consists of:
Vehicle TitleMotorist's LicenseInsurance Information5. Setting the New Key
For transponder keys and smart keys, the brand-new key may require programs to sync with the vehicle's ignition system. Car dealerships are generally much better equipped for this task, however numerous locksmith professionals can likewise handle programs.
6. Evaluating the Key
As soon as the new key is acquired and configured, it's important to check it to guarantee it works correctly with the vehicle's ignition and locks.
Expenses of Replacement Car Keys
The expense of replacing car keys can vary considerably based on the vehicle type and the key itself. Below is a summary of approximated costs for various types of car keys:
Type of KeyEstimated Cost RangeBasic Key₤ 2 - ₤ 10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 200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 500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 600Elements Influencing Cost
Several aspects can influence the total cost of replacing car keys:
Manufacturer: Luxury cars tend to have more pricey keys.Key Programming: More advanced keys need specific shows devices.Geographical Location: Replacement costs can vary substantially by area.Frequently Asked Questions About Replacement Car Keys1.
